127853
PROFESSOR P. FORD; PROFESSOR ENERITUS, SOUTHAMPTON UNIVERSITY, MRS. G. FORD; CHIEF EDITORIAL ADVISORS.

Irish University Press Series of British Parliamentary Papers, Correspondence and Papers, Relating to Emigration, Pitcairn's Island, and Other Affairs in Australia 1857. Colonies Australia 22.
Facsimile Edition; F'cap Folio (335x205 mm); pp. 672; original green cloth boards with quarter leather binding, title and publisher lettered in gilt on spine, top edges gilt, a fine copy.
Shannon Ireland; Irish University Press; 1969.
Important volume, contains among others several sections (pp.60) of correspondence relating to the Removal of Inhabitants of Pitcairn's Island to Norfolk Island, two sections ( pp. 20) relating to gold discovery and exports, Copy of the Charter of the Bank of Australia, correspondence relating to a Federal Association of Australian Colonies, Correspondence on the Australian Mail Service, Electoral laws for Victoria and Tasmania, etc. Click here to Order

127850
PROFESSOR P. FORD; PROFESSOR ENERITUS, SOUTHAMPTON UNIVERSITY, MRS. G. FORD; CHIEF EDITORIAL ADVISORS.

Irish University Press Series of British Parliamentary Papers, Correspondence and Papers Relating to The Mail Service, South Sea Islanders, The Appropriation Act of Victoria, and Other Affairs in Australia 1864-69. Colonies Australia 25.
Facsimile Reproduction; F'cap Folio (335x205mm); pp. 720; folding Sketch Map of Part of Western Tasmania by Charles Gould; original green cloth boards with quarter leather binding, title and publisher lettered in gilt on spine with raised bands, gilt to top edges: previous owner's bookplate on front endpaper otherwise a fine copy.
Shannon Ireland, Irish University Press, (1969).
An important Volume in this series as it contains over 300 pages of correspondence relating to the Non-enactment of the Appropriation Act (Victoria), in addition to a very interesting report from the Government Geologist on Gold in Van Diemen's Land, several sections covering correspondence and reports relating to the Australian Mail Service, several sections on Queensland and the Importation of South Sea Islanders, etc Click here to Order
